Guidelines for Storing A Sealed Lead-Acid Battery:Store the battery after fully charging itStore it at room temperature or lowerRemove the battery from the equipmentCharge it every 6 months, or as recommended by the manualAvoid deep dischargeChoose proper float voltages to avoid sulfation and corrosion

A lead acid battery cell is approximately 2V. Therefore there are six cells in a 12V battery – each one comprises two lead plates which are immersed in dilute Sulphuric Acid (the electrolyte) – which can be either liquid or a gel. The lead oxide and is not solid, but spongy and has to be supported by a grid.

6 FAQs about [How to maintain energy storage lead-acid batteries]

How do you maintain a lead-acid battery?

By following these maintenance practices, you can significantly extend the life of your lead-acid batteries and ensure optimal performance in all your applications. Store batteries in a cool, dry place. The ideal temperature for storage is between 10°C and 25°C.

How long can a sealed lead-acid battery be stored?

A sealed lead-acid battery can be stored for up to 2 years. During that period, it is vital to check the voltage and charge it when the battery drops to 70%. Low charge increases the possibility of sulfation. Storage temperature greatly affects SLA batteries. The best temperature for battery storage is 15°C (59°F).

Do lead-acid batteries need maintenance?

Lead-acid batteries discharge over time even when not in use, and prolonged discharge can permanently damage them. By following these maintenance practices, you can significantly extend the life of your lead-acid batteries and ensure optimal performance in all your applications.

How long do lead-acid batteries last?

Lead-acid batteries typically last between 3 to 5 years, but with regular testing and maintenance, you can maximize their efficiency and reliability. This guide covers essential practices for maintaining and restoring your lead-acid battery. What are lead-acid batteries and how do they work?

What happens if you store a lead-acid battery incorrectly?

Proper storage of lead-acid batteries is essential to prevent damage and extend their lifespan. Storing them incorrectly can lead to significant issues that reduce their performance and longevity. Storing batteries in hot environments can cause them to dry out and lose electrolyte, leading to sulfation.

How often should a lead acid battery be charged?

Lead-acid batteries can lose their charge over time, even when not in use. Check the charge at least once every three months and recharge if the voltage drops below 70% of its full capacity. Keep track of charging status during storage. Use a maintenance or float charger to keep the battery charged at an optimal level without risk of overcharging.
